From db77f058c92ee3d0b531c474093d6a3d1d81cd25 Mon Sep 17 00:00:00 2001
From: Jean-Noel Rouvignac <jean-noel.rouvignac@forgerock.com>
Date: Mon, 26 May 2014 12:17:41 +0000
Subject: [PATCH] Ensured no accidental protocol break can happen by renaming all ByteArrayBuilder.append*() methods and getting rid of all method overloading.
---
opends/src/server/org/opends/server/replication/protocol/UpdateMsg.java | 14 +++++++-------
1 files changed, 7 insertions(+), 7 deletions(-)
diff --git a/opends/src/server/org/opends/server/replication/protocol/UpdateMsg.java b/opends/src/server/org/opends/server/replication/protocol/UpdateMsg.java
index 28febb3..04ac885 100644
--- a/opends/src/server/org/opends/server/replication/protocol/UpdateMsg.java
+++ b/opends/src/server/org/opends/server/replication/protocol/UpdateMsg.java
@@ -220,12 +220,12 @@
{
final ByteArrayBuilder builder =
new ByteArrayBuilder(bytes(6) + csnsUTF8(1));
- builder.append(msgType);
- builder.append((byte) ProtocolVersion.getCurrentVersion());
- builder.appendUTF8(getCSN());
- builder.append(assuredFlag);
- builder.append(assuredMode.getValue());
- builder.append(safeDataLevel);
+ builder.appendByte(msgType);
+ builder.appendByte((byte) ProtocolVersion.getCurrentVersion());
+ builder.appendCSNUTF8(getCSN());
+ builder.appendBoolean(assuredFlag);
+ builder.appendByte(assuredMode.getValue());
+ builder.appendByte(safeDataLevel);
return builder;
}
@@ -281,7 +281,7 @@
{
final ByteArrayBuilder builder = encodeHeader(MSG_TYPE_GENERIC_UPDATE,
ProtocolVersion.getCurrentVersion());
- builder.append(payload);
+ builder.appendByteArray(payload);
return builder.toByteArray();
}
--
Gitblit v1.10.0